replit features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Replit offers an intuitive interface that makes it easy to start coding without needing to set up development environments. This can significantly lower the barrier to entry for beginners.
  • Collaborative Coding
    Replit facilitates real-time collaboration, allowing multiple users to work on the same codebase simultaneously, similar to tools like Google Docs.
  • Supports Multiple Languages
    Replit supports a wide range of programming languages including Python, JavaScript, C++, and many more. This makes it flexible for users with different needs.
  • Cloud-Based
    Being a cloud-based platform, Replit enables users to access their code from any device with an internet connection, eliminating the need for local storage.
  • Built-in Package Manager
    Replit comes with built-in package managers for various languages, making it easier to include third-party libraries and dependencies.
  • Educational Tools
    The platform offers various resources for educators, such as interactive coding environments and classroom management tools, making it ideal for academic settings.

Possible disadvantages of replit

  • Performance Limitations
    Being a cloud-based IDE, Replit may encounter performance issues for larger projects or those requiring intensive computational resources.
  • Limited Customization
    The environment may lack some customization options and advanced settings available in traditional, locally-installed IDEs.
  • Dependency on Internet
    Since it's cloud-based, an active internet connection is mandatory for coding, which can be a drawback in situations with unreliable internet access.
  • Privacy Concerns
    Hosting code on a third-party platform may raise privacy and security issues, especially for proprietary or sensitive projects.
  • Subscription Costs
    While Replit offers a free tier, advanced features, higher resource limits, and premium support come at a subscription cost, which may be a barrier for some users.
  • Limited Debugging Tools
    The platform's debugging tools may not be as robust as those available in more established, dedicated IDEs.

Less features and specs

  • Simplifies CSS
    Less extends CSS with dynamic behavior like variables, mixins, operations, and functions, making stylesheets more maintainable and less repetitive.
  • Preprocessing
    Allows developers to write easier and cleaner code which then gets compiled into standard CSS, facilitating better performance and compatibility.
  • Variables and Mixins
    With the ability to use variables and mixins, code becomes modular and reusable, reducing the potential for errors and simplifying updates.
  • Nested Syntax
    Supports nested syntax which allows CSS to be structured in a manner that follows the same visual hierarchy, making it easier to read and understand.
  • Compatibility
    Compatible with all versions of CSS, making it easier to integrate with existing projects and frameworks without breaking them.

Possible disadvantages of Less

  • Learning Curve
    Requires developers to learn new syntax and concepts, which can be a barrier for those who are accustomed to traditional CSS.
  • Compilation Requirement
    Code written in Less needs to be compiled to CSS, adding an extra step in the development process.
  • Performance Overhead
    While not significant, the preprocessing step can add to development time and require additional configuration and tools.
  • Debugging
    Debugging Less can be more challenging compared to plain CSS because source maps need to be set up properly to map the compiled CSS back to the Less files.
  • Dependency
    Relies on Node.js or another JavaScript runtime for compiling the Less code, adding another dependency to the project.

Analysis of Less

Overall verdict

  • Yes, Less is considered a good tool for developers looking to enhance their CSS with additional features that improve code organization and reusability. It's particularly praised for its simplicity and ease of use, making it a solid choice for both new and experienced developers.

Why this product is good

  • Less is a CSS pre-processor that allows for more efficient and manageable styling of web projects. It extends the capabilities of CSS with variables, nested rules, mixins, and functions, making it easier to maintain and scale large stylesheets. Developers can write more concise code, which is then compiled into standard CSS. This makes Less particularly useful for projects that require complex styling structures.
